To help you arm yourself with the information you need to make your decision, Course Advisor has developed this Best Value English Language & Literature Graduate Certificate Schools in Pennsylvania ranking.
This ranking is not just a list of inexpensive schools. We also consider each school's quality, since we believe a low-quality school may not be a 'bargain' at any price. More specifically, we discount our quality score by the published tuition and fees charged by a school. This gives the cost per unit of quality for each college. The value is determined by how much quality your dollar buys.
For nationwide and regional rankings, we use out-of-state tuition and fees in our calculations. Average in-state tuition and fees are used for our statewide rankings.
Best English Language & Literature Graduate Certificate School
Our analysis found Millersville University of Pennsylvania to be the best value school for English language and literature students who want to pursue a graduate certificate in Pennsylvania. Located in the suburb of Millersville, Millersville is a public school with a moderately-sized student population.
Millersville graduate students pay an average of $11,934 in in-state tuition and fees each year.
